Output 70e957f7456d566aa58c58cbb622573c3189c58531c27d3234c615f4a31235b7:20

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f5a12869e262761094e8c9950bb40f10a2d534d OP_EQUAL
address
3APC274nn28yrf9tAT6vxQifmLzgiGsT4K
transaction
70e957f7456d566aa58c58cbb622573c3189c58531c27d3234c615f4a31235b7
spent
true